Workspace and room setup

Rooms are compact but well thought-out, featuring genuine oak floorboards, crafted furniture, and a king-sized bed as the centrepiece. City Rooms look out over the Bukit Bintang skyline, while Courtyard Rooms add a daybed, Nespresso machine, and pool-facing views — a real upgrade for longer stays. Artist Lofts offer full living areas stocked either with art supplies or a curated personal library. Aēsop toiletries, flat-screen TVs, air conditioning, and safety deposit boxes come standard across all categories. Free WiFi covers the entire property, and work desks provide a functional spot to set up without taking over the bed.

Atmosphere and design

KLoé opened in 2020 built around a simple idea: a hotel that feels genuinely Malaysian, not generic. Every room features furniture and artwork by local artists and designers, giving the place a grounded, specific identity. The building is arranged around a courtyard with open-air walkways and lush green walls, which creates a surprisingly calm atmosphere given you're a two-minute walk from Pavilion mall. The Lucky Coffee Bar runs from breakfast through late evening, offering cocktails and quality coffee in a setting that feels like a neighbourhood spot rather than a hotel bar.

Location

KLoé sits on Jalan Bukit Bintang in the heart of one of KL's busiest and most visitor-friendly neighbourhoods. Pavilion Kuala Lumpur is a two-minute walk, and Jalan Alor food street is about seven minutes on foot — easily walkable for dinner. The Raja Chulan monorail station is close by, and Bukit Bintang MRT gives direct access to KL Sentral, Chinatown, and further out. The hotel is set slightly back from the main road, which reduces street noise without isolating you from the action.
